User-generated content platforms: AI search visibility ranking (2026)
How AI search engines rank user-generated content platforms by visibility and citations. 20 brands measured monthly across Google AI Mode: which brands the AI names in answers, which domains it cites as sources, and how the leaders compare. UGC platforms used to collect customer photos, videos, reviews, and creator assets for social proof, paid media, product pages, and brand campaigns. Composite score: 70% visibility (% of AI answers naming the brand) + 30% citation rate (% citing the brand's domain). Full methodology →

What we observed in this category
Yotpo leads the category with a composite score of 23.8, well ahead of second-ranked Insense at 11.2 and third-ranked Flowbox at 8.8. Every other brand in the top 10 scores exactly 0.0. The category average visibility sits at just 1.2 percent, meaning even the leader's 12.5 percent visibility represents a commanding but fragile position. The gap between Yotpo and the rest of the field is large enough that a single period of reduced AI inclusion could materially shift rankings.
Insense presents the clearest divergence between visibility and citation in this dataset. It holds a 37.5 percent citation rate despite zero visibility, meaning Google AI Mode references or links to insense.pro without naming it as a brand in response text. Flowbox shows the inverse pattern, with 12.5 percent visibility but zero citations. Yotpo is the only brand achieving meaningful scores on both dimensions simultaneously, suggesting it is the only brand the AI both names and trusts as a source in this category.
The top cited sources list reveals that Google AI Mode anchors heavily on third-party and review-style domains when constructing answers in this category. Influee.co, cohley.com, showca.se, and influencer-hero.com all appear as cited sources despite none ranking as named brands in the top 10. YouTube also features, indicating the AI draws on video content for UGC platform queries. This pattern suggests the AI treats comparison and aggregator sites as authoritative references rather than the platform vendors' own domains.

How to read this ranking
Four things worth knowing before you act on the numbers above. These are the same definitions across every industry page — for category-specific observations, see the What we observed section above (where available) and the per-brand insights inline in the ranking.
Visibility = being named
A brand's visibility % is the share of AI answers that mention it by name in the response prose. This is who AI engines actively recommend to the buyer. More on visibility →
Citation rate = being trusted
Citation rate is the share of AI answers that include the brand's domain as a clickable source link. This is what the AI treats as authoritative evidence, different from being named. More on citation rate →
Top engine differs by brand
The "top engine" column shows which AI surface each brand performs best on. Big gaps between a brand's score across engines usually points to specific content or schema gaps. How AI engines pick sources →
Rankings move month to month
AI engines re-crawl and re-rank on shorter cycles than classical search. We re-audit every brand on this list at least every 30 days and refresh this page automatically. How AI search ranking works →
